  • Gertrude Ederle

    Gertrude Ederle
    Gertrude Ederle became the first woman to swim the English Channel. she was 20 when she made her historic swim on aug. 6. "People said women couldn't swim the channel," but she said "I proved they could."
  • Billie Jean King

    Billie Jean King
    Billie Jean King was former professional tennis player from the United States. She won 12 Grand Slam singles titles, 16 Grand Slam women's doubles titles, and 11 Grand Slam mixed doubles titles.
